Masquer le sommaire

Opérateurs de conditions pour les transitions de flux de travail

Quand vous définissez des conditions pour des transitions de flux de travail, vous pouvez utiliser les opérateurs suivants de la colonne Comparaison.

L'opérateur est sélectionné sous Comparaison et est utilisé avec la valeur pour déterminer quels fichiers respectent la condition.

Les opérateurs de comparaison qui sont disponibles dépendent du type de variable que vous sélectionnez.

Dans le tableau qui suit :

  • Les valeurs de recherche sont sensibles à la casse.
  • Les comparaisons de nombres fonctionnent mieux si le type de variable est "nombre".
  • Les comparaisons de dates fonctionnent mieux si le type de variable est "date".

    Notez que le format de la comparaison de dates dépend du format de date attribué globalement dans les propriétés du coffre-fort.

  • Les guillemets dans les exemples ne sont pas nécessaires.
  • Les conditions de flux de travail mises à niveau ou importées essaient de correspondre au type de comparaison selon l'opérateur utilisé dans la valeur.
  • Si vous voulez comparer des valeurs dans des fichiers avec des configurations, et si certaines configurations ont des valeurs différentes dans leurs cartes de données, vous devez définir dans la colonne Configuration une configuration nommée à laquelle comparer la valeur. Par exemple, saisissez @ pour toujours comparer des valeurs de l'onglet de configuration @ dans la carte de données.
Opérateur L'expression est vraie si Exemple
Text_Equal_to.gif Texte égal à La valeur définie correspond à une chaîne de texte exacte dans une variable. La valeur "bride" correspond aux fichiers avec la valeur de variable "bride" exacte mais pas "bride inférieure" ou "grille". Si vous laissez la valeur vide, tous les fichiers qui n'ont pas une valeur dans cette variable correspondent.
Text_Not_Equal_to.gif Texte non égal à La valeur définie ne correspond pas à une chaîne de texte exacte dans une variable. La valeur "bride" correspond à des fichiers avec n'importe quelle valeur de variable qui n'est pas "bride", par exemple "grille" ou "bride supérieure". Si vous laissez la valeur vide, tous les fichiers qui ont une valeur dans cette variable correspondent.
Text_Less_Than.gifTexte inférieur à Une chaîne de texte dans une variable est alphabétiquement antérieure à la valeur définie. La valeur "ecad" correspondrait à des fichiers avec la valeur de variable "acad" mais pas "ecad" ou "mcad".
Text_Bigger_Than.gifTexte supérieur à Une chaîne de texte dans une variable est alphabétiquement postérieure à la valeur définie. La valeur "ecad" correspondrait à des fichiers avec la valeur de variable "mcad" mais pas "ecad" ou "acad".
Text_Less_Than_or_Equal.gifTexte inférieur ou égal à Une chaîne de texte dans une variable est alphabétiquement antérieure ou égale à la valeur définie. La valeur "ecad" correspondrait à des fichiers avec la valeur de variable "acad" ou "ecad" mais pas "mcad".
Text_Bigger_Than_or_Equal.gifTexte supérieur ou égal à Une chaîne de texte dans une variable est alphabétiquement postérieure ou égale à la valeur définie. La valeur "ecad" correspondrait à des fichiers avec la valeur de variable "mcad" ou "ecad" mais pas "acad".
Text_Contains.gifLe texte contient La valeur définie correspond à une chaîne de texte partielle dans une variable. La valeur "fin" correspondrait à des fichiers avec la valeur de variable "état de surface" ou "mise en plan terminée"
Text_Does_Not_Contain.gif Le texte ne contient pas La valeur définie ne correspond à aucune partie d'une chaîne de texte dans une variable. La valeur "fin" correspondrait à des fichiers avec la valeur de variable "mise en plan complète" mais pas "mise en plan terminée".
Text_Compare.gifComparer le texte Autorise l'utilisation d'opérateurs de comparaison dans l'expression. Voyez le tableau suivant.
Number_Equal_To.gifNombre égal à La valeur définie correspond au nombre exact dans une variable. La valeur "123" correspondrait à des fichiers avec la valeur de variable "123" mais pas "12" ou "1234".
Number_Not_Equal_To.gifNombre non égal à La valeur définie ne correspond pas au nombre exact dans une variable. La valeur "123" correspondrait à des fichiers avec n'importe quel nombre outre "123" dans la valeur de variable, par exemple "12" ou" 1234"
Number_Less_Than.gif Nombre inférieur à Un nombre dans une variable est numériquement inférieur à la valeur définie. La valeur "123" correspondrait à des fichiers avec la valeur de variable "1,23", "12", "122" mais pas "123", "123,4" ou "1234"
Number_Bigger_Than.gifNombre supérieur à Un nombre dans une variable est numériquement supérieur à la valeur définie. La valeur "123" correspondrait à des fichiers avec la valeur de variable "123,4", "124" ou "1234" mais pas "1,23"," 12", "122" ou "123"
Number_Less_Than_or_Equal.gifNombre inférieur ou égal à Un nombre dans une variable est numériquement inférieur ou égal à la valeur définie. La valeur "123" correspondrait à des fichiers avec la valeur de variable "1,23", "12", "122" ou "123" mais pas "123,4" ou "1234"
Number_Bigger_Than_or_Equal.gifNombre supérieur ou égal à Un nombre dans une variable est numériquement supérieur ou égal à la valeur définie. La valeur "123" correspondrait à des fichiers avec la valeur de variable "123", "123,4", "124" ou "1234" mais pas "1,23", "12", "122"
Date_Equal_To.gifDate égale à La valeur correspond à une date exacte dans une variable. La valeur "7/30/2012" correspondrait à des fichiers avec la valeur de variable "7/30/2012" mais "7/30/2011", "7/29/2012" ou "8/30/2012"
Date_Not_Equal_To.gif Date non égale à La valeur définie ne correspond pas à une date exacte dans une variable. La valeur "7/30/2012" correspondrait à des fichiers avec n'importe quelle date outre "7/30/2012" dans la valeur de variable, pour l'exemple "7/30/2011", "7/29/2012" ou "8/30/2012"
Date_Less_Than.gifDate inférieure à Une date dans une variable est antérieure à la valeur de date définie. La valeur "7/30/2012" correspondrait à des fichiers avec la valeur de variable "7/30/2011", "7/29/2012" mais pas "7/30/2012" ou "8/30/2012"
Date_Bigger_Than.gifDate supérieure à Une date dans une variable est postérieure à la valeur de date définie. La valeur "7/30/2012" correspondrait à des fichiers avec la valeur de variable "8/30/2012" mais pas "7/30/2011", "7/29/2012" ou "7/30/2012"
Date_Less_Than_or_Equal.gifDate inférieure ou égale à Une date dans une variable est antérieure ou égale à la valeur de date définie. La valeur "7/30/2012" correspondrait à des fichiers avec la valeur de variable "7/30/2011", "7/29/2012" ou "7/30/2012" mais pas "8/30/2012"
Date_Bigger_Than_or_Equal.gifDate supérieure ou égale à Une date dans une variable est postérieure ou égale à la valeur de date définie. La valeur "7/30/2012" correspondrait à des fichiers avec la valeur de variable "7/30/2011" ou "8/30/2012" mais pas "7/30/2011" ou "7/29/2012"
Yes_No_operator Egal ou non à La valeur correspond la valeur de variable Oui ou Non.

S'applique aux variables qui utilisent le type "Oui ou Non".

La valeur "Oui" correspondrait aux fichiers dont la variable "Oui ou Non" est définie sur "Oui" (c.-à-d. dont la case est cochée).

Opérateurs de comparaison pour Comparer le texte

Opérateur Description Exemple
> Supérieure à >123
< Inférieure à <123
>= Supérieur ou égal à >=123
<= Inférieur ou égal à <=123
!= Différent de !=123
% (pourcentage) Toute chaîne de zéro caractère ou plus A l'argument %fich% correspondent "fichier", "afficher", "affichage" et "afficheur"
_ (trait de soulignement) Tout caractère A l'argument _cad correspondent "ecad" et "mcad"
[chars] (caractères) Tout caractère dans l'ensemble ou la plage A Rév[A1] correspondent "RévA" et "Rév1". A Rév[A-C] correspondent "RévA", "RévB" et "RévC"
[^chars] (caractères) Tout caractère qui n'est pas dans l'ensemble ni dans la plage A l'argument de[^xyz]% correspondent toutes les chaînes commençant par "de", où la lettre suivante n'est ni "x", ni "y", ni "z".


Faire un commentaire sur cette rubrique

Tous les commentaires concernant la présentation, l'exactitude et l'exhaustivité de la documentation sont les bienvenus. Utilisez le formulaire ci-dessous pour faire parvenir vos commentaires et suggestions directement à notre équipe de documentation. Celle-ci ne peut pas répondre aux questions de support technique. Cliquez ici pour des informations sur le support technique.

* Requis

 
*Courriel:  
Sujet:   Commentaires sur les rubriques d'aide
Page:   Opérateurs de conditions pour les transitions de flux de travail
*Commentaire:  
*   Je reconnais avoir pris connaissance et accepter par la présente la politique de confidentialité en vertu de laquelle mes données personnelles seront utilisées par Dassault Systèmes

Rubrique d'impression

Sélectionner l'étendue du contenu à imprimer :

x

La version du navigateur que vous utilisez est antérieure à Internet Explorer 7. Afin d'optimiser l'affichage, nous suggérons d'utiliser Internet Explorer 7 ou une version ultérieure.

 Ne plus afficher ce message
x

Version du contenu de l'aide sur le Web: SOLIDWORKS PDM 2015 SP05

Pour désactiver l'aide sur le Web dans SOLIDWORKS et utiliser l'aide locale à la place, cliquez sur ? > Utiliser l'aide sur le Web de SOLIDWORKS.

Pour signaler tout problème rencontré avec l'interface ou la fonctionnalité de recherche de l'aide sur le Web, contactez votre support technique local. Pour faire part de vos commentaires sur des rubriques d'aide individuelles, utilisez le lien “Commentaires sur cette rubrique” sur la page de la rubrique concernée.